LEXINGTON, Va. – The Randolph girls’s swimming crew opened the 2025-26 season the annual ODAC Relays hosted Washington and Lee University. The meet consists of ODAC colleges and the groups compete in solely relay occasions. The crew completed seventh over with a complete rating of 47 factors.

Katelyn Spuchesi, Katya Zaitsev, Taylor Eshelman, and Rio Bucy of the A crew completed ninth general in 100 Yard Relay in 51.49 seconds. The B squad completed in seventeenth with a 56.95, consisting of Alaura Arringdale, Reaghan Quinn, Taylor Kitts, and Maddie Dyl.

In the 3×50 Yard Fly Relay, the A crew completed tenth, Spuchesi, Eshelman, and Kaitlyn Heckman, with a time of 1:30.28.

For the 3×50 Yard Back Relay, the crew completed 14th in 1:40.71 consisting of Heckman, Bucy, and Reaghan Quinn. In the 3×50 Yard Breast Relay, Arringdale, Quinn, and Dyl completed 14th in 2:00.29.

The 400 Yard Free Relay noticed Heckman, Bucy, Arringdale, and Zaitsev swim a 4:21.24 for sixteenth general.

Spuchesi, Eshelman, and Bucy made up the 3×100 Yard IM Relay and swam a time of three:31.60 for eleventh. The 500 Yard Relay crew of Eshelman, Heckman, Bucy, and Spuchesi swam a 5:22.64 for twelfth place. The 200 Yard Medley Relay squad of Heckman, Eshelman, Spuchesi, and Zaitsev got here in fifteenth with a 2:09.11.

Quinn, Zaitsev, Dyl, and Kitts got here in 14th within the 100 Yard Relay underwater fly kick, every swimmer doing a butterfly kick underwater. Their time was 1:18.89.

In the 200 Yard Free Relay, the crew completed 14th. Zaitsev, Quinn, Arringdale, and Kitts completed with a time of 1:18.89. 

The crew returns house for his or her house opener on Saturday at 1 p.m. They will face William Peace, Hollins, and Gallaudet.
